How to Use Your Citroen Key Fob Smartly

FIAT.pngMany car owners don't know that their key fobs are equipped with some pretty cool functions. You can choose to summon your car like Tesla or use the Panic button to stop intruders from your home, these tips can be helpful in an emergency.

Key fobs get a lot of physical abuse, and they aren't indestructible. It's relatively easy to fix an unusable keyfob.

Keyless Entry

Modern automobiles are equipped with key fobs that allow the owner to unlock and start the car without having to insert a physical key into the ignition barrel. Keys with transponders contain a chip that sends a coded signal to the car when inserted, and only when it is correct is the vehicle able to start.

Key fobs offer a myriad of built-in features, many that the owners aren't aware of, but could be very useful when needed. Engine Start

It is possible to turn your car on or off using a special key fob. The system makes sure that the engine will only turn on when the key fob is in close proximity. This feature can be particularly beneficial in colder weather since it allows you to heat or precool your car from the comfort of your home.

If your car shows an error message that says "key not detected" Try placing your keyfob close to the steering column or on newer vehicles, place it inside the central armrest bin, the dashboard or cupholder. It should then be possible to use the keyfob to press START to start the car.

A low battery on the key fob warning symbol on the dash could indicate that the batteries in the key fob are very low. The batteries will have to be replaced. This is very easy and can be done on the go since most keys can be opened so that the replacement batteries can be inserted into. Most electronics stores carry the CR2025 and CR2032 3-Volt batteries. Check your owner's manual for the details or YouTube videos on how to do this.
